Description

The Department of Homeless Services (DHS) is seeking appropriately qualified vendors to operate Tier II residences, which operate in accordance with New York State Codes, Rules and Regulations, Title 18, Part 900 (18 NYCRR 900), which provide temporary housing accommodations and social services to homeless families until viable housing alternatives become available. Tier II residences must provide, at a minimum, social services, assistance in seeking permanent housing, assistance in seeking employment and linkages to childcare and medical and behavioral (mental health and substance use) health care and recreation services. Services are provided on-site and/or through linkages with other community-based programs. Additionally, Non-Tier II certified residences would be expected to provide the same services as those listed above while certification as a Tier II is pending. Lighthouse, at 38-59 11th Street., Long Island City, NY 11101 (Round 14).
